In the earliest stages of the Nike Zoom KD IV, the design team played around with a few materials and structural pieces to make this early sample of the Nike Zoom KD IV. The all-new Adaptive Fit system was to be the highlight component of the Zoom KD IV, and here we see the familiar KD IV upper affixed with the Adaptive Fit strap, but with an outsole taken from the Nike Hyperfuse. This Innovation Kitchen-born sample also features the netted material seen the lightweight Hyperfuse, and a different ‘KD’ logo on the heel, which is stated to be a sticker.
